The Wedding Planner
The wedding planner is a unique individual who thrives on pressure, creativity and timelines, (think of Jo-Lo with the headset and clipboard) and their role is longer in nature than most of your other vendors, because they are a couple’s main point of contact throughout their wedding journey. A wedding planner is responsible for helping you PLAN and EXECUTE all elements of your wedding day, from offering vendor recommendations, to contract negotiations, determining and maintaining your budget, offering styling and design concepts, coordinating travel and accommodation, to implementing all of the planned elements of your wedding day. According to Brides.com a wedding planner may spend anywhere between 80 – 250 hours organising and implementing your celebration and wedding planners on the Tweed Coast generally charge $5000+ for this service.
The Wedding Coordinator
The wedding coordinator, whilst just as savvy on the organizational and creative front, has a shorter-term, but just as crucial role in your wedding. They allow you the freedom to do the bulk of the planning for your wedding and will generally swoop in around 6 weeks before your big day to take over the reins and help you finalise the finer details of the day. A coordinator will bring all your hard work together, starting off with a run sheet of the day, reconfirming vendors bookings and requirements, become the point of contact for enquiries in the immediate lead up and with their keen eye and professional experience, ensure that there is no hiccups on the horizon for you. They take the pressure off you and your love one, ensuring things happen as they should, so the two of you can relax and make the most of your day. Brides.com estimate a coordinator clocks up around 25 hours per wedding and the standard pricing for a coordinator in the Tweed Region is $1000 – $1500.
